Can I cook Bar-S hot dogs on a shared grill?

When it comes to cooking hot dogs on a shared space, it’s essential to prioritize food safety to avoid any unpleasant experiences. If you’re planning to cook Bar-S hot dogs on a shared grill, make sure to take some precautions. First, always check the grill’s cleanliness before placing your hot dogs. If the grill is dirty or has remnants of previous foods, give it a good scrub with a grill brush to prevent cross-contamination. Next, cook your hot dogs to an internal temperature of at least 160°F (71°C) to ensure they’re thoroughly cooked and safe for consumption. You can use a food thermometer to check the internal temperature. Additionally, consider bringing a portable grill or grill mat to create a barrier between your food and the shared grill surface. By taking these simple steps, you can enjoy your Bar-S hot dogs on a shared grill while keeping food safety top of mind.
